How to fish it · for Atlantic Salmon
When
Morning into early afternoon.
Where
Pool tails, steadier runs, and any water with pace.
Method
Fish a sensible line-and-fly combination for the height and pace of water.
Kit
13 ft #8/9 double-hander in spate, 10 ft #8 single in low water. Floating line plus a fast-sink tip. 12–15 lb fluoro tippet.
Why this works
Water at 19.5°C — above the atlantic salmon caution line (18°C). Fish dawn or dusk only. Land it fast, wet hands, no air shots.
